Newly promoted Senior Vice President, Culture & Human Resources Michelle Rashid has been instrumental in rolling out the company's matrixed structure and elevating its talent base for growth, all with a tireless dedication to ensuring the company's values-driven culture supports its core purpose of enriching lives through human connection- something Virtuoso is well known for. A 17-year Virtuoso veteran, Rashid assumed responsibility for the company's culture ten years ago and has since developed and implemented the infrastructure to support the global offices, which have realised significant expansion over the past 18 months. Her duties have grown to address the complexities of global talent management and the continually expansive labour laws around the world. In her elevated role, she is responsible for driving the vision and execution of organisational design and leadership effectiveness, including strategic talent acquisition, retention and special talent initiatives, all which support the company's overall organisational health and business results. She has helped to establish a number of leadership development programs, including the creation of the Next Level Leaders group, while also supporting the integration of sustainability practices into the organization.

Laura Simmons joined Remington Hotels in 2011 and has over 25 years of comprehensive HR generalist experience. As VP of Corporate HR, Laura will oversee the lifecycle of our corporate associates including associate engagement, performance and development. Laura began her HR career with Wyndham Hotels, where she held regional and corporate HR leadership roles and was a key task force member for 19 hotel openings throughout the nation. Previously, Laura served the corporate human resources function where she oversaw the performance management function for Remington corporate, Premier Project Management, and Ashford Hospitality. Laura also spearheads the corporate volunteer events and is a champion for associate recognition programs.
